Archaeological Museum of Acaxochitlán
In Mexico known as: Museo Arqueológico de Acaxochitlán
Museum Overview
Location & Contact
Address
Benito Juárz s/n, Palacio Municipal
Centro Histórico
Acaxochitlán, Hidalgo 43720
Phone
Website
Museum Information
Founded
2011
Affiliation
Patronato de Acaxochitlán para la Conservación del Patrimonio, Cultural e Histórico, A.C.
Introduction
Explore the Museo Arqueológico de Acaxochitlán, a compact gateway to the region's ancient cultures and local artifacts. This welcoming museum offers a focused look at Hidalgo's archaeology, nestled in the Palacio Municipal area for a convenient, easy day of discovery.
